Output 66b777c34e7609f45f562dde1014bff7132e18e7ca43613e6aa62209976099db:0

value
150795094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7f0a3d625fde6195dd3721bd86d2998fdd97857 OP_EQUALVERIFY OP_CHECKSIG
address
LbzYCH3H117V5G7NeEXKGizKuTnzfVhX1F
transaction
66b777c34e7609f45f562dde1014bff7132e18e7ca43613e6aa62209976099db
spent
true